What Is Real-Time PCR?
PCR stands for polymerase chain reaction. This method allows
scientists to make many copies of DNA or RNA from a small sample. Real-time
PCR, also called quantitative PCR, measures the DNA as it is being copied. This
means scientists can see the results quickly without waiting until the end of
the process. Real-time PCR is widely used in clinical labs, research
facilities, and environmental testing because it can detect even tiny amounts
of harmful organisms.

Why Real-Time PCR Analysis Software Matters?
Hardware is important, but software is just as critical.
Real-time PCR analysis software helps scientists understand the data collected
during the test. It can separate the target DNA from other signals, check for
possible contamination, and create clear reports. When this software is used
with the XDive instrument, it makes the whole process easier and more accurate.
Results are faster, and lab staff can make decisions more confidently.
In medical labs, this is especially important. Detecting
pathogens early allows doctors to start treatment sooner, which can improve
patient outcomes. In food and water testing, rapid detection prevents
contaminated products from reaching the public.
